+FILE_LICENCE ( GPL2_OR_LATER );
+
+#include <string.h>
+#include <errno.h>
+#include <ipxe/init.h>
+#include <ipxe/efi/efi.h>
+#include <ipxe/efi/efi_driver.h>
+#include <ipxe/efi/Protocol/LoadedImage.h>
+
+/** Image handle passed to entry point */
+EFI_HANDLE efi_image_handle;
+
+/** Loaded image protocol for this image */
+EFI_LOADED_IMAGE_PROTOCOL *efi_loaded_image;
+
+/** System table passed to entry point */
+EFI_SYSTEM_TABLE *efi_systab;
+
+/** Event used to signal shutdown */
+static EFI_EVENT efi_shutdown_event;
+
+/* Forward declarations */
+static EFI_STATUS EFIAPI efi_unload ( EFI_HANDLE image_handle );
+
+/**
+ * Shut down in preparation for booting an OS.
+ *
+ * This hook gets called at ExitBootServices time in order to make
+ * sure that everything is properly shut down before the OS takes
+ * over.
+ */
+static EFIAPI void efi_shutdown_hook ( EFI_EVENT event __unused,
+                                      void *context __unused ) {
+       shutdown_boot();
+}
+
+/**
+ * Look up EFI configuration table
+ *
+ * @v guid             Configuration table GUID
+ * @ret table          Configuration table, or NULL
+ */
+static void * efi_find_table ( EFI_GUID *guid ) {
+       unsigned int i;
+
+       for ( i = 0 ; i < efi_systab->NumberOfTableEntries ; i++ ) {
+               if ( memcmp ( &efi_systab->ConfigurationTable[i].VendorGuid,
+                             guid, sizeof ( *guid ) ) == 0 )
+                       return efi_systab->ConfigurationTable[i].VendorTable;
+       }
+
+       return NULL;
+}
+
+/**
+ * Initialise EFI environment
+ *
+ * @v image_handle     Image handle
+ * @v systab           System table
+ * @ret efirc          EFI return status code
+ */
+EFI_STATUS efi_init ( EFI_HANDLE image_handle,
+                     EFI_SYSTEM_TABLE *systab ) {
+       EFI_BOOT_SERVICES *bs;
+       struct efi_protocol *prot;
+       struct efi_config_table *tab;
+       void *loaded_image;
+       EFI_STATUS efirc;
+       int rc;
+
+       /* Store image handle and system table pointer for future use */
+       efi_image_handle = image_handle;
+       efi_systab = systab;
+
+       /* Sanity checks */
+       if ( ! systab ) {
+               efirc = EFI_NOT_AVAILABLE_YET;
+               goto err_sanity;
+       }
+       if ( ! systab->ConOut ) {
+               efirc = EFI_NOT_AVAILABLE_YET;
+               goto err_sanity;
+       }
+       if ( ! systab->BootServices ) {
+               DBGC ( systab, "EFI provided no BootServices entry point\n" );
+               efirc = EFI_NOT_AVAILABLE_YET;
+               goto err_sanity;
+       }
+       if ( ! systab->RuntimeServices ) {
+               DBGC ( systab, "EFI provided no RuntimeServices entry "
+                      "point\n" );
+               efirc = EFI_NOT_AVAILABLE_YET;
+               goto err_sanity;
+       }
+       DBGC ( systab, "EFI handle %p systab %p\n", image_handle, systab );
+       bs = systab->BootServices;
+
+       /* Look up used protocols */
+       for_each_table_entry ( prot, EFI_PROTOCOLS ) {
+               if ( ( efirc = bs->LocateProtocol ( &prot->guid, NULL,
+                                                   prot->protocol ) ) == 0 ) {
+                       DBGC ( systab, "EFI protocol %s is at %p\n",
+                              efi_guid_ntoa ( &prot->guid ),
+                              *(prot->protocol) );
+               } else {
+                       DBGC ( systab, "EFI does not provide protocol %s\n",
+                              efi_guid_ntoa ( &prot->guid ) );
+                       /* Fail if protocol is required */
+                       if ( prot->required )
+                               goto err_missing_protocol;
+               }
+       }
+
+       /* Look up used configuration tables */
+       for_each_table_entry ( tab, EFI_CONFIG_TABLES ) {
+               if ( ( *(tab->table) = efi_find_table ( &tab->guid ) ) ) {
+                       DBGC ( systab, "EFI configuration table %s is at %p\n",
+                              efi_guid_ntoa ( &tab->guid ), *(tab->table) );
+               } else {
+                       DBGC ( systab, "EFI does not provide configuration "
+                              "table %s\n", efi_guid_ntoa ( &tab->guid ) );
+                       if ( tab->required ) {
+                               efirc = EFI_NOT_AVAILABLE_YET;
+                               goto err_missing_table;
+                       }
+               }
+       }
+
+       /* Get loaded image protocol */
+       if ( ( efirc = bs->OpenProtocol ( image_handle,
+                               &efi_loaded_image_protocol_guid,
+                               &loaded_image, image_handle, NULL,
+                               EFI_OPEN_PROTOCOL_GET_PROTOCOL ) ) != 0 ) {
+               rc = -EEFI ( efirc );
+               DBGC ( systab, "EFI could not get loaded image protocol: %s",
+                      strerror ( rc ) );
+               goto err_no_loaded_image;
+       }
+       efi_loaded_image = loaded_image;
+       DBGC ( systab, "EFI image base address %p\n",
+              efi_loaded_image->ImageBase );
+
+       /* EFI is perfectly capable of gracefully shutting down any
+        * loaded devices if it decides to fall back to a legacy boot.
+        * For no particularly comprehensible reason, it doesn't
+        * bother doing so when ExitBootServices() is called.
+        */
+       if ( ( efirc = bs->CreateEvent ( EVT_SIGNAL_EXIT_BOOT_SERVICES,
+                                        TPL_CALLBACK, efi_shutdown_hook,
+                                        NULL, &efi_shutdown_event ) ) != 0 ) {
+               rc = -EEFI ( efirc );
+               DBGC ( systab, "EFI could not create ExitBootServices event: "
+                      "%s\n", strerror ( rc ) );
+               goto err_create_event;
+       }
+
+       /* Install driver binding protocol */
+       if ( ( rc = efi_driver_install() ) != 0 ) {
+               DBGC ( systab, "EFI could not install driver: %s\n",
+                      strerror ( rc ) );
+               efirc = EFIRC ( rc );
+               goto err_driver_install;
+       }
+
+       /* Install image unload method */
+       efi_loaded_image->Unload = efi_unload;
+
+       return 0;
+
+       efi_driver_uninstall();
+ err_driver_install:
+       bs->CloseEvent ( efi_shutdown_event );
+ err_create_event:
+ err_no_loaded_image:
+ err_missing_table:
+ err_missing_protocol:
+ err_sanity:
+       return efirc;
+}
+
+/**
+ * Shut down EFI environment
+ *
+ * @v image_handle     Image handle
+ */
+static EFI_STATUS EFIAPI efi_unload ( EFI_HANDLE image_handle __unused ) {
+       EFI_BOOT_SERVICES *bs = efi_systab->BootServices;
+       EFI_SYSTEM_TABLE *systab = efi_systab;
+
+       DBGC ( systab, "EFI image unloading\n" );
+
+       /* Shut down */
+       shutdown_exit();
+
+       /* Disconnect any remaining devices */
+       efi_driver_disconnect_all();
+
+       /* Uninstall driver binding protocol */
+       efi_driver_uninstall();
+
+       /* Uninstall exit boot services event */
+       bs->CloseEvent ( efi_shutdown_event );
+
+       DBGC ( systab, "EFI image unloaded\n" );
+
+       return 0;
+}
